3,000 cyclists keep green mission in high gear at KL race


Tan (right) and Naquib (second from right) at the flag-off in Kuala Lumpur.

A RECORD 3,000 cyclists converged in the capital city for the eighth edition of OCBC Cycle Kuala Lumpur.

Spanning 25km of closed roads, the event had the longest non-overlapping stretch since the series began.
